How to Get Mint Retrograde & the God Roll in Destiny 2

In simple terms, the game Mint Retrograde is available for all players without requiring The Edge of Fate expansion. To obtain Mint Retrograde, players should navigate to the Pinnacle Ops section within The Portal. By completing any exotic mission in this area, they might receive a Pinnacle Ops Gear Engram. This engram could potentially drop the Mint Retrograde item. Players are advised to regularly check the Pinnacle Ops section daily to see if the reward rotation has changed, as certain missions may offer Focused Loot, ensuring a guaranteed drop of Mint Retrograde for farming the perfect setup, or “god roll”.

Stop Killing Games Petition Reaches Important New Milestone

As CEO of Ubisoft, Yves Guillemot has recently expressed his viewpoint about the controversy surrounding Stop Killing Games. His comments centered around the notion that publishers should not be held responsible for providing services indefinitely, suggesting that at some stage, these services might cease operation. Although this statement does not directly address the issue of consumers losing access to games they have bought, it appears to reflect a shared viewpoint among industry professionals, such as Video Games Europe.
